基于Three.js的粒子特效网页设计源码


2.虚拟产品一经售出概不退款(资源遇到问题,请及时私信上传者)
本项目为基于Three.js的粒子特效网页设计源码,包含42个文件,涵盖17个PNG图片、10个JavaScript脚本、3个GLB模型、2个Markdown文档、2个SVG矢量图、2个WASM文件、1个Git忽略文件、1个HTML页面、1个JSON配置和1个CSS样式文件。项目通过JavaScript和CSS实现动态粒子特效,适用于网页增强视觉效果。 在计算机图形学与网页设计领域,Three.js已成为实现3D图形设计的热门工具之一,特别是对于创建丰富的粒子特效。本项目展示了如何运用Three.js及相关的前端技术,设计出既美观又具有互动性的网页元素。该项目包含了一个完整的文件集合,涵盖了网页设计从静态元素到动态特效所需的所有资源。 我们来看看项目中的图像资源,包括PNG图片和SVG矢量图。在网页设计中,图像资源的使用至关重要,它们不仅能够丰富页面内容,还能提升用户体验。PNG图片以其透明背景而受到青睐,通常用于网页背景、图标和设计元素。而SVG矢量图则能够保持高清晰度不变形,适应不同的屏幕尺寸,适用于创建具有交互性的图形。 接着是JavaScript脚本,这些脚本文件是项目实现动态粒子特效的核心。通过JavaScript可以控制粒子的生成、运动和消失,实现各种视觉效果。同时,JavaScript脚本还可以处理用户交互,响应用户操作来改变粒子特效的表现,从而增强网页的互动性。 HTML页面是网页设计的基础结构,它通过标签和元素定义了网页的布局和内容。在本项目中,HTML页面会调用JavaScript脚本和CSS样式文件,以实现粒子特效的展示。而CSS样式文件则负责整个网页的设计和视觉布局,包括颜色、字体、间距等样式设置,确保粒子特效与网页整体风格相协调。 此外,项目还包含了GLB模型文件,GLB格式是一种基于JSON的3D模型文件格式,用于存储3D图形数据,如顶点、纹理坐标、法线和材质等。这类文件使得开发者能够在网页上展示复杂的3D模型,与粒子特效结合,创造出更为震撼的视觉效果。 值得一提的是,Three.js框架使得开发者能够以较低的学习成本使用WebGL,WebGL是一种JavaScript API,用于在不需要插件的情况下在Web浏览器中渲染3D图形。Three.js提供的各种预制组件和工具,使得3D图形的设计和交互更为简便。 在项目的文件结构中,还包含了package.json和yarn.lock文件,这两个文件是前端项目中常见的依赖管理文件。它们记录了项目所需的依赖包及其版本,便于开发者维护项目的依赖关系,并确保不同开发环境中项目的稳定性和一致性。而readme.txt文件则通常用于说明项目的相关信息,如安装指南、使用方法、版权说明等,有助于其他开发者了解和使用项目源码。 本项目不仅包含丰富的资源文件,还涵盖了实现粒子特效网页设计所需的技术要点。通过对Three.js框架的运用,结合多种前端技术,该项目能够实现动态、互动、视觉上吸引人的网页设计,为用户提供独特的网页浏览体验。


















































































- 1


- 粉丝: 1647
我的内容管理 展开
我的资源 快来上传第一个资源
我的收益
登录查看自己的收益我的积分 登录查看自己的积分
我的C币 登录后查看C币余额
我的收藏
我的下载
下载帮助


最新资源
- 中原工学院网络规划书.doc
- 汇智湖”软件园高层办公楼门窗幕墙施工组织技术方案正本.doc
- 计算机组成原理思维导图.doc
- 在线社区网站的研究设计与实现.doc
- 多国人工智能产业加速发展.docx
- 教育部参赛项目一认识PLC黄振健.doc
- 小学语文网络设计方案集.doc
- 大数据人才求贤若渴.docx
- 在计算机平面设计教学中强调美术基础的重要性.docx
- 大数据时代的数字图书馆建设研究.docx
- 网络工程师考试试题及答案.doc
- 三层电梯PLC控制系统设计方案报告.doc
- 如何做好移动互联网流量经营.docx
- 2006年4月计算机等考三级PC技术笔试真题及标准答案.doc
- 计算机考试资料级公共基础.doc
- 大学英语语音教学中网络资源的运用.docx


